Re: Certificate Courses in IIT Bombay

Certification Course on Coating Inspection and Quality Control course offered in 2003 by IITB or Indian Institute of Technology, Bombay was designed for persons interested in broadening their theoretical and practical knowledge about Coatings and Linings, including Manufacturers and Plant Maintenance personnel, Engineers applicators, Contractors, Architects sales and marketing personnel

Course Details

Theoretical Knowledge Level 1 Course

Fundamental knowledge of Corrosion
Basic of paint coatings and chemistry of various kinds of paints, resins and formulations and their relation to corrosion protection.
Conventional and advanced coating systems
Surface preparation Methods with latest standards and specifications.
Paint Application techniques and best application practice mantras
Reasons for Paint Failure and its Mechanisms
Paint repair and rehabilitation maintenance Coatings
How to write paint specifications
Safety aspects in paint coating application.

Supplement for Level 2 Course
Paint Applications :
Chemical and other allied industries
Offshore structures
Underground pipelines
Rebars for RCC Structures and Coatings for concrete
Coatings for Ships
Automotive paint Coatings

Practical Knowledge
1. Surface preparation
Each participant was asked to carry out surface preparation using blast cleaning method, asses its cleanliness as per NACE/SSPC /Swedish Standards and also measure its surface profile.

2. Paint Application
Various methods of paint application ranging from brush, roller, air-spray, airless spray were demonstrated and each applicant was asked to prepare own sample.

3. Paint Testing
Divided into following three categories:

i) Paint Characterization - % Volume solid, Total non volatile component, density, viscosity, drying time, surface coverage, paint wastage calculations etc.
ii) Mechanical Testing Adherence, pull out strength, impact, abrasion, scratch, flexibility, hardness, etc.
iii) Chemical Resistance Salt spray, humidity, weathering and immersion tests
iv) Miscellaneous Tests : Cathodic Disbondment, moisture/water permeability, high and low temperature resistance
